Prep steps matter: remove personal items, set fuel to a quarter tank, fold mirrors, disable toll tags, and note existing marks.

Relocation and Timing Tips
Align vehicle delivery with move-in appointments and elevator schedules.
Send photos of the curb, dock, or garage entrance.
If curb space is limited, consider early morning or late evening windows.
